Python对象
一、不可变对象
Number数字
String字符串
从上述代码中可以看出,不能够改变字符串的内容,但是可以改变str这个变量指向的位置
Tuple元组
可以看到Tuple的指向是可以修改的,就是Tuple这个元组的变量名字tuple1,你可以决定tuple1让其指向谁,但是你不能改变其指向内容的修改。
二、可变对象
List列表
Dictionary字典
四、Set集合说明
1.python中set集合是一种无序的,可变的书籍类型
2.集合中元素是不会重复的
3.集合可以进行交集,并集,差集等操作
4.使用{}大括号来表示
5.集合中重复的元素会被去掉
# set可以进行集合运算
a = set('abracadabra')
b = set('alacazam')
print(a)
print(a - b) # a 和 b 的差集
print(a | b) # a 和 b 的并集
print(a & b) # a 和 b 的交集
print(a ^ b) # a 和 b 中不同时存在的元素
下图中是A和B的差集
# a 和 b 的并集
# a 和 b 的交集
# a 和 b 中不同时存在的元素
python中的集合和数学中集合概念一样!
五、Dictionary字典说明
六、List,Tuple,Set,Dictionary
List=[]来表示
Tuple=()来表示
Set={}来表示